现有100ml无色气体,其中可能含有NH3,CO2,HCL,NO中的一种或几种,把气体通过浓H2SO4,气体体积减少了30ml,在把所剩气体通过Na2O2固体,气体体积又减少了30ml,气体变为红棕色,最后剩余气体通入水中,收集到20ml无色气体(相同条件下),试计算原混合气体中各组分的体积。
參考答案:NH3 30ml
CO2 70/3 ml
HCL 80/3 ml
NO 20ml
很久没有做过化学题了,应该是这样的:
第一个过程只有NH3可以被浓硫酸吸收,故30ml;
第二个过程涉及多个化学方程式,故先分析第三个:
根据化学方程式
3NO2+H2O=NO+2HNO3
2NO+O2=2NO2
进行配平相加有4NO+3O2+2H2O=4HNO3
根据体积减少20ml得知NO为20ml
最后在第二个过程中用差量法计算得到上述结果。